Ingredients
Ina Garten’s Chocolate Cake is so decadent and incredibly tender. It has a rich chocolate buttercream frosting and is topped with Chocolate Crispearls for decoration.
For the Cake
- 1/2 cup vegetable oil
- 1 cup buttermilk
- 2 large eggs (lightly beaten)
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 3/4 cups all-purpose flour
- 2 cups granulated sugar
- 3/4 cups cocoa powder
- 2 teaspoons baking soda
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1 cup freshly brewed hot coffee
For the Frosting
- 6 ounces semi-sweet baking chocolate (chopped)
- 1 cup butter (room temperature)
- 1 large egg yolk
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 2 1/4 cups powdered sugar
- 1 tablespoon instant coffee granules
- 2 teaspoons hot water
How to Make Ina Garten’s Chocolate Cake
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Begin by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ease two 9-inch round cake pans with butter or cooking spray to prevent sticking.
Step 2: Mix Wet Ingredients
In a large mixing bowl, combine:
1. Vegetable oil
2. Buttermilk
3. Lightly beaten eggs
4. Vanilla extract
Whisk together until well blended.
Step 3: Combine Dry Ingredients
In another bowl, mix together:
1. All-purpose flour
2. Granulated sugar
3. Cocoa powder
4. Baking soda
5. Baking powder
6. Salt
Stir these dry ingredients until they are evenly combined.
Step 4: Combine Mixtures
Gradually add the dry mixture into the wet mixture while stirring gently.
- Pour in the freshly brewed hot coffee slowly as you mix.
- Ensure there are no lumps in the batter; it should be smooth.
Step 5: Bake the Cakes
Divide the batter evenly between the prepared pans. Bake in the preheated oven for about 38 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
Step 6: Cool the Cakes
Once baked, remove the cakes from the oven and let them cool in their pans for about 10 minutes before transferring them to a cooling rack to cool completely.
Step 7: Prepare Frosting
While cakes are cooling, make your frosting:
1. Melt chopped semi-sweet chocolate over a double boiler or microwave.
2. In a mixing bowl, beat room temperature butter until creamy.
3. Add egg yolk and vanilla extract; mix well.
4. Gradually add powdered sugar while continuing to beat together until fluffy.
5. Dissolve instant coffee granules in hot water; then add to frosting mixture along with melted chocolate.
Step 8: Frost the Cake
Once cakes are completely cooled:
1. Place one layer on a serving plate and spread frosting generously on top.
2. Place the second layer on top of the first and frost the sides and top of the cake.
3. Finish with an elegant sprinkle of Chocolate Crispearls for decoration.

How to Perfect Ina Garten’s Chocolate Cake
To make sure your Ina Garten’s Chocolate Cake turns out perfectly every time, here are some handy tips.
- Use room temperature ingredients: This helps in achieving a smooth batter and even baking.
- Sift dry ingredients: Sifting flour and cocoa powder eliminates lumps and ensures even distribution in the batter.
- Don’t overmix: Mix until just combined to keep the cake tender; overmixing can lead to a tough texture.
- Check for doneness: Insert a toothpick in the center; it should come out clean or with a few moist crumbs, not wet batter.
- Cool completely before frosting: Allowing the cake to cool prevents melting your frosting and makes it easier to spread.
- Store properly: Keep leftovers covered at room temperature for up to three days or refrigerate for longer freshness.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
When baking Ina Garten’s Chocolate Cake, it’s easy to make some common mistakes. Here are a few to watch out for:
- Using cold ingredients: Cold eggs or butter can lead to a dense cake. Always bring your ingredients to room temperature for the best results.
- Overmixing the batter: Mixing too much can create a tough texture. Mix just until combined for a tender cake.
- Not measuring accurately: Incorrect measurements can ruin the balance of flavors and textures. Use a kitchen scale or measuring cups for precision.
- Skipping the coffee: Coffee enhances the chocolate flavor in this cake. Don’t skip it; use freshly brewed hot coffee for optimal taste.
- Ignoring cooling time: Cutting the cake before it cools can cause it to crumble. Allow it to cool completely for clean slices.

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Refrigerator Storage
- Store in an airtight container for up to 5 days.
- If layered with frosting, place parchment paper between layers to avoid sticking.
Freezing Ina Garten’s Chocolate Cake
- Wrap individual slices in plastic wrap and aluminum foil for up to 3 months.
- For whole cakes, double wrap and seal in a freezer-safe container.
Reheating Ina Garten’s Chocolate Cake
- Oven: Preheat to 350°F (175°C), place the cake on a baking sheet, and warm for 10-15 minutes.
- Microwave: Heat individual slices on medium power for 15-20 seconds until warm.
- Stovetop: Place slices in a skillet over low heat, cover, and warm gently for 5-7 minutes.
Frequently Asked Questions
Here are some common questions about Ina Garten’s Chocolate Cake:
What makes Ina Garten’s Chocolate Cake so special?
Ina Garten’s Chocolate Cake is known for its rich texture and deep chocolate flavor, thanks to high-quality cocoa powder and coffee.
Can I use different types of flour?
While all-purpose flour is recommended, you can experiment with gluten-free flour blends. Just be aware that texture may vary.
How can I customize this cake?
Feel free to add nuts, chocolate chips, or even fruit like raspberries between layers or as toppings!
Is there a way to reduce sugar in this recipe?
You can reduce sugar slightly, but keep in mind that it affects both sweetness and moisture. Try reducing by one-third for a less sweet version.
How do I store leftover frosting?
Store any leftover chocolate buttercream frosting in an airtight container in the fridge for up to one week. Rewhip before using.
